Overview
- Wolves have guaranteed their Premier League status for the 2025-26 season under Pereira, following a six-match winning streak, their best top-flight run since 1970.
- Pereira’s philosophy of resilience stems from his challenging upbringing in Espinho, Portugal, where he lived in a cave and faced severe hardships.
- The manager’s fan-centric approach, including his ‘first the points, then the pints’ mantra, has deepened his connection with supporters, who have embraced his leadership style.
- Pereira emphasizes intelligent squad building over big spending as Wolves prepare for the summer transfer window, with uncertainty surrounding the future of forward Matheus Cunha.
- With extensive international experience, Pereira has leveraged his diverse tactical insights to engineer Wolves' dramatic turnaround since his December 2024 appointment.
